linuxpid命令
-
“ps”命令是Linux系统中用于显示进程信息的命令之一。它可以显示当前运行的进程以及它们的相关信息,如进程ID(PID)号、进程名称、父进程ID(PPID)号、进程状态、运行时间等。
你提到的”linuxpid”可能是笔误,因为Linux系统中并没有专门的”linuxpid”命令。如果你想要查找特定进程的进程ID,可以使用”ps”命令结合其他参数来实现。
例如,要查找名为”firefox”的进程的进程ID,可以使用以下命令:
ps -ef | grep firefox
该命令会显示包含关键词”firefox”的进程信息。在输出中,你可以找到该进程的PID号,并作为答案使用。
另外,如果你想要获取某个进程的PID号并将其保存到一个变量中,你可以使用以下命令:
pid=$(ps -ef | grep firefox | grep -v grep | awk ‘{print $2}’)
这条命令会将包含关键词”firefox”的进程ID保存到变量”$pid”中,方便后续使用。
总而言之,”ps”命令是Linux系统中获取进程信息的常用工具,通过结合其他参数和命令可以实现对进程ID的查找和获取。
2年前 -
Linux中的`pid`命令用于获取指定进程的进程ID(PID)。
以下是关于Linux中的`pid`命令的五个要点:
1. `pid`命令的语法:`pid <进程名>`。例如,要获取`apache2`进程的PID,可以使用命令:`pid apache2`。
2. `pid`命令是一个自定义的shell脚本,它使用`pgrep`命令来获取进程ID。`pgrep`命令根据给定的进程名返回进程ID。`pid`命令还使用`ps`命令来显示进程的详细信息。
3. 使用`pid`命令可以方便地检查某个特定进程的进程ID,这在管理和调试进程时非常有用。比如,如果要停止一个进程,但不知道其进程ID,可以使用`pid`命令来获取它。
4. `pid`命令还可以结合其他命令使用,比如`kill`命令来终止进程。例如,要终止`apache2`进程,可以使用以下命令:`kill $(pid apache2)`。
5. `pid`命令还可以用来监视进程的状态。它可以在一个循环中使用,以便持续检查进程是否处于活动状态。这对于自动化脚本和监控进程的健康状态非常有用。
2年前 -
linux中的pid命令是用来获取或显示进程ID的命令。PID代表进程标识符,是一个唯一的数字,用来区分每个正在运行的进程。PID命令可以帮助用户获取进程的PID,以及查看进程的详细信息。
在Linux中,PID命令有两种常见的用法:
1. 获取进程的PID
“`shell
pidof <进程名>
“`执行以上命令可以获取指定进程名的PID。例如,如果要获取所有名为”nginx”的进程的PID,可以执行以下命令:
“`shell
pidof nginx
“`2. 查看进程详细信息
“`shell
ps -p“` 执行以上命令可以查看指定PID的进程的详细信息。例如,如果要查看PID为1234的进程的详细信息,可以执行以下命令:
“`shell
ps -p 1234
“`此外,还可以使用ps命令的其他选项来查看进程的详细信息,比如:
“`shell
ps -ef # 查看所有进程的详细信息
ps aux # 查看更详细的进程信息
“`以上是PID命令的基本用法。在实际应用中,还可以结合其他命令和选项来进行更复杂的操作。比如,可以使用管道符(|)将PID命令与其他命令结合起来,对进程进行筛选和排序。
“`shell
pidof nginx | xargs ps -f # 获取指定进程名的PID,并查看其详细信息
“`这条命令先执行pidof命令获取进程名为”nginx”的PID,然后通过管道将PID传递给xargs命令,并结合ps -f命令查看进程的详细信息。
通过PID命令,用户可以方便地获取进程的PID,并查看进程的详细信息,从而进行进程管理和调试。
2年前